UL, LLC Engineer Project Associate - Wind Turbine - Type Testing in Bangalore, India

  • Determines project scope, develops a preliminary plan of investigation, and determines project specifications such as cost, time, and sample requirements by analyzing client input, available supplemental data, and product construction.

  • Projects may include travel to conduct or witness tests at client sites. Initiates communication with clients to promote and explain the benefits of new and existing services.

  • Follows up on contacts from clients.

  • Communicates with clients to discuss technical issues, explain UL procedures and requirements, convey project cost, and negotiate completion date and sample requirements.

  • Acts to address client concerns and to resolve client issues.

  • Provides technical assistance to clients in reference to product inspection and follow-up services.

  • Is familiar with applicable standards, company manuals and appropriate technical literature.

  • Coordinates administrative aspects of project management.

  • Serves as Project Handler of record and may sign as Reviewer of record as assigned.

  • Communicates project status and results to clients through frequent contact and by preparing reports.

  • Prepares Follow-Up Service Procedures and information pages.

  • Integrates continuous improvement concepts and techniques into all aspects of the job.

  • Resolves engineering issues associated with Variation Notices by analyzing and reporting on the acceptability of the variations.

  • Assists in the development of UL requirements.

  • May represent UL at industry related functions such as seminars and trade shows.

  • Read and follow the Underwriters Laboratories Code of Conduct and follow all physical and digital security practices.

  • Performs other duties as directed.
